Bulgaria - Paddy Rice Yield
Since 2014, Bulgaria Paddy Rice Yield rose 4.1% year on year. With 60,000 Hectograms Per Hectare in 2019, the country was number 26 comparing other countries in Paddy Rice Yield. Bulgaria is overtaken by North Korea, which was ranked number 25 at 60,186 Hectograms Per Hectare and is followed by Vietnam with 58,165 Hectograms Per Hectare. Australia topped the ranking with 87,710 Hectograms Per Hectare in 2019, -15.6% compared to 2018. Tajikistan, United States and Egypt resp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Tanzania witnessed the best average annual growth at +13.5% per year, while Zimbabwe witnessed the worst performance at -29.4% per year.
